Concrete Foundation Types
Concrete foundations play an essential role in the stability and longevity of all structures, as they provide the necessary support for the complete structure. Several primary types of concrete foundations exist, each suited to different soil conditions and structural needs. The most common types include slab foundations, which feature one continuous, thick layer of concrete; crawl space foundations, which elevate structures above ground; and basement foundations, which provide additional living space and storage. Every type carries distinct advantages, such as simplified construction, affordability, or improved insulation. Understanding these variations is vital for choosing the right foundation that aligns with the specific requirements of the project, guaranteeing a strong foundation for any building effort.
Importance Of Proper Reinforcement
Reinforcement acts as a crucial element in guaranteeing the resilience and longevity of concrete foundations. Effective reinforcement methods, such as the use of steel rebar or fiber additives, enhance the overall structural integrity by providing tensile strength that plain concrete cannot provide. This combination significantly minimizes the possibility of structural cracking and failure under various loads and environmental conditions. Furthermore, proper reinforcement facilitates better dispersal of stress throughout the concrete foundation, contributing to longevity and performance. Structural engineers need to assess considerations like load demands and soil characteristics when designing reinforcement plans. By prioritizing proper reinforcement, property owners can secure their assets and guarantee the foundations have the capability to withstand the challenges of time, effectively supporting the overall structure.
Methods For Foundation Repair
Foundation repair strategies are fundamentally important in upholding the structural soundness of properties, especially when issues arise from inadequate reinforcement or environmental factors. Common methods include underpinning, which strengthens the foundation by extending it deeper into stable soil, and slab jacking, a process in which a specialized mixture is pumped under concrete slabs to raise and align them. A further approach utilizes helical piers, which are positioned to offer reinforcement in compromised soil environments. Additionally, wall anchors can stabilize bowing walls by redistributing forces. Every technique is customized to address particular concerns, guaranteeing successful restoration and extending the longevity of the building. Comprehensive analysis by skilled specialists is vital to selecting the best approach for a successful foundation repair outcome.

Cutting-Edge Techniques in Decorative Concrete Finishes
Turning conventional surfaces into remarkable works of art, cutting-edge approaches in decorative concrete finishes have become increasingly favored among architects and designers. These approaches elevate aesthetic appeal while ensuring durability and functionality. Processes such as stamping, staining, and engraving provide a broad spectrum of textures and colors, simulating materials like stone or wood without the corresponding maintenance costs.
Stenciling delivers elaborate designs, facilitating unique patterns that can transform any area. Furthermore, the incorporation of exposed aggregate highlights unique stone combinations, adding a natural touch to all surfaces.
New innovations, highlighted by the introduction of green pigments and sealers, have further supported the long-term viability of architectural concrete coatings. By incorporating state-of-the-art technology, professionals can attain vivid colors and durable outcomes.

How to Properly Maintain and Care for Your Concrete Installations
Following the selection of a experienced concrete professional, looking after concrete surfaces is essential to secure their durability and performance. Routine cleaning is necessary; buildup and discoloration ought to be cleared without delay to stop deterioration. A thorough but gentle pressure wash can effectively eliminate buildup and contaminants while keeping the surface intact.
Sealing concrete surfaces periodically is important to prevent moisture infiltration and staining. This strengthens the surface while enhancing its overall appearance. Throughout the colder months, the use of de-icing agents must be prevented, as they can result in cracks and surface flaking.
Cracks must be treated right away with the proper repair compounds to stop further degradation. Additionally, excessive weight should be controlled to avoid undue stress on the concrete structure. By following these upkeep guidelines, homeowners can ensure that their concrete structures stay functional and aesthetically pleasing for years to come.

Can Concrete Be Recycled After Its Useful Life?
Indeed, concrete can be recycled after its useful life. It is frequently crushed and repurposed as base material in fresh concrete mixes or used in various construction projects, thereby reducing waste and conserving resources in the environment.

How Does Weather Impact Concrete Curing Times?
Atmospheric conditions have a major impact on concrete curing times. Elevated temperatures speed up the evaporation process, while cooler conditions tend to hinder proper hardening. Ambient humidity is another important consideration, with too much moisture being capable of causing surface defects, compromising the long-term durability of the structure.
